The doctor charged with tainting IV bags at a North Dallas surgery center was appointed a public defender Friday to represent him during his initial appearance before a federal magistrate.
Ortiz is charged with putting drugs into IV bags at the Baylor Scott & White Surgicare North Dallas where he worked. Ten patients suffered cardiac emergencies as a result, prosecutors said, and a fellow doctor,Kaspar, who also was an anesthesiologist, wasn’t feeling well and took an IV bag home to rehydrate herself, said her husband John Kaspar.John Kaspar attended Friday’s court hearing and spoke outside to reporters.He called his wife a “quality anesthesiologist.
“To see the accusations against another anesthesiologist is terrible,” he said. “It’s hard to comprehend.” A detention hearing was set for Monday at 10 a.m. Prosecutors said they would seek to have him detained pending trial.
